--2504uJlMzHih+KB5 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=us-ascii Content-Disposition: inline Hi, I'm looking at the problem of translating CUPS ptal: URIs into hp: URIs, so that upgrading Fedora Core from an hpoj-based set-up to an HPLIP-based one works. ptal:/mlc:usb:PSC_2200_Series | V hp:/usb/PSC_2200_Series?serial=MY2CVF42CR0G As far as I can tell, this can't be done without the actual device present and enabled, because ptal: URIs don't have as much information in as hp: URIs. Is my only hope to have the "update configuration" program run the CUPS 'hp' backend, looking for possible matches?
